Samsung Electronics enters AI data center cooling

Samsung Electronics is moving beyond refrigerators and air conditioners into the much hotter market for AI data center cooling, a pivot that could give the South Korean company a new source of growth as demand for traditional consumer appliances slows and capital spending on artificial intelligence infrastructure accelerates.
The strategic logic is clear: AI servers generate far more heat than conventional computing equipment, and data center operators are increasingly turning to advanced cooling systems to keep energy costs and uptime under control. That makes thermal management one of the less visible but more economically important parts of the AI buildout, alongside chips, networking gear and power systems.

For Samsung, the opportunity is not just about selling more equipment. It is about moving into a higher-value part of the infrastructure stack where margins can be better defended than in mature home-appliance categories. The company has long had expertise in air conditioning, compressors and building climate systems, but data center cooling would push it into a market shaped by hyperscale cloud operators, colocation providers and enterprise IT buyers — customers that buy in bulk and care as much about efficiency and service as upfront price.
The timing also matters. Global investment in AI infrastructure is forcing data center operators to rethink how facilities are designed, with liquid cooling and other advanced thermal systems gaining share from traditional air-based setups. Suppliers that can offer integrated cooling solutions stand to benefit as operators look to cut electricity use and manage rising rack densities. That has already helped draw rivals such as Carrier Global and other climate-control specialists deeper into the segment.

For Samsung, the bull case is that data center cooling becomes a durable adjacent business that leverages its manufacturing scale and brand credibility in climate systems. The bear case is that the market proves crowded, pricing remains competitive and the transition from consumer hardware to enterprise infrastructure takes longer than hoped. Either way, the move highlights a broader industrial shift: as AI spending migrates from semiconductors into the physical infrastructure that supports them, thermal management is becoming a strategic market in its own right.
Investors will be watching whether Samsung follows the familiar appliance playbook — volume, scale and distribution — or whether it can build the service and systems capability needed to win contracts in a data center market that is still being defined. Success would give the company a new growth engine at a time when its legacy businesses are under pressure to do more than just cycle with the consumer economy.
